Job Overview

The Fairview, NC Product Engineering group supports a variety of production lines for relays and contactors used within aerospace and defense applications. As part of this group, the candidate will primarily perform Electrical Engineering tasks under the supervision of the Product Engineering Manager. The candidate will also be required to collaborate on a wider range of tasks, including, but not limited to, production support, test equipment development and support, and new product industrialization, including software creation. The successful candidate should be able take on a wide range of tasks such as mechanical design, and basic electrical and mechanical testing all while working independently.

ABOUT TE CONNECTIVITY

TE Connectivity plc (NYSE: TEL) is a global industrial technology leader creating a safer, sustainable, productive, and connected future. As a trusted innovation partner, our broad range of connectivity and sensor solutions enable the distribution of power, signal and data to advance next-generation transportation, energy networks, automated factories, data centers enabling artificial intelligence, and more.

Our more than 90,000 employees, including 10,000 engineers, work alongside customers in approximately 130 countries. In a world that is racing ahead, TE ensures that EVERY CONNECTION COUNTS. Learn more at and on LinkedIn, Facebook, WeChat, Instagram and X (formerly Twitter).
